Liquor outlets will once again be able to pick up stocks as the High Court on Wednesday allowed sales of liquor from Telangana Beverages Corporation Ltd (TSBCL) depots. A division bench of Chief Justice Kalyan Jyoti Sengupta and Justice P.V. Sanjay Kumar granted an interim stay on the attachment notice served by the Income Tax department on TSBCL depots.

Addressing counsel representing the income-tax department , Justice Kalyan Sengupta said, “If the sales are stopped, how will the I-T department get its tax due? Let them sell. Only then can the department collect the tax.”

While granting interim stay on the notices served by the I-T wing, the bench directed the TSBCL to supply the list of stocks available in depots to the I-T and then sell the stocks while remitting the money into a separate account after deducting expenditure.

The bench also directed the corporation to give all sale proceedings before the court by next Tuesday to take an appropriate decision on the issue.
